硅谷传奇创业者+精神领袖 Guy Kawasaki最近写了一篇新文章总结了以下5种说服他人的技巧。希望对大家对付老外有帮助。摘要如下:
- 先给予,后索取 (Be the first to give )。研究表明,我们容易被给我们帮过忙的人说服:有些服务员给我们结账的时候带来口香糖,我们一般给他们的小费多些。工作中我们更倾向于给帮助过我们的人更多支持…
- 不要给对方太多选择 (don’t offer too many choices):不论是给用户选择,还是给员工的奖励机制,太多的选择经常会给人带来挫折感…
- 不要以自我为中心辩护(argue against self-interest)。在说服别人的过程中,信任是最关键的。有时候在大力鼓吹之前承认自己方面的一些小不足可以提高信任感…
- 失去比得到更有说服力 (losses are more persuasive than gains)。告诉对方如果不接受你的意见或者不买的你的产品会失去什么,要比只是说明他们会得到什么要更能说服人…
- 让对方觉得自己已经取得了一定进步 (make people feel as if they’ve already made progress toward a goal)。例如以下两种推销洗车会员卡服务的方法,方法2的顾客保持率是方法1的两倍。
- 洗八次赠一次
- 洗十次车赠一次,第一次算免费赠送
原文link
mailper 杂项资源, 职场生涯 Guy Kawasaki
此课程有全部讲义和习题。
课程描述实在得令人发指。翻译如下:
您是否由于自己的Python程序比同僚们的C程序慢而垂头丧气?你是否想不用JAVA实现面向对象?加入我们,学习C和C++吧!我们带您从简单的C程序入手,深入C语言的内存管理,简介C++里的面向对象,深入C++面向对象的高级功能以及STL。我们还教您一些以后面试用得着的技巧和知识。
原文:
Ever hang your head in shame after your Python program wasn’t as fast as your friend’s C program? Ever wish you could use objects without having to use Java? Join us for this fun introduction to C and C++! We will take you through a tour that will start with writing simple C programs, go deep into the caves of C memory manipulation, resurface with an introduction to using C++ classes, dive deeper into advanced C++ class use and the C++ Standard Template Libraries. We’ll wrap up by teaching you some tricks of the trade that you may need for tech interviews.
麻省理工开放课程里有很多计算机科学的宝贝。不仅有一流的教程,还有习题和答案。适合英语不错的程序员平时充电。
课程地址(英文)
mailper C/C++语言, 技术读物, 编程语言 C++
公司有时候会举行团队建设活动,让大家出去跋山涉水,一起做有肢体接触游戏(例如用废报纸和胶布搭建一个能把所有人容下的遮阳棚)。这其中是有道理的。
今日读到一篇加州伯克利大学的文章 touch, cooperation, and performance, 用科学的研究方法解释了为什么NBA球员们为什么要“high five(击掌)”,并用统计方法论证了碰触行为可以导致更好的比赛成绩。其实想想,其实人们握手,鼓励式地拍肩膀,引导别人进门的时候好客地推别人的背,道理都是一样。身体接触(符合社交礼仪范围的)是建立信任的一种微妙行为。这些大多不会写在领导力的书里。
猴子之间互相捉虱子梳理毛发不是为了营养,而是增进群体的凝聚力。人类口头上的语言的第一功能不是为了表达知识,而是为了促进社会联系,其内容并不需要都是重要信息。这就是为什么我们一天之内说话内容的80%其实都是扯淡,八卦和闲聊。
(注意:职场上有社交礼仪,此方法需要适度)
mailper 职场生涯 team work
Google最近发布了一个全世界可以开放查询的数据平台,其中包含了多种宏观数据,并且有很方便的作图方式。
http://www.google.com/publicdata/directory
其中有一项是世界各国人均GDP
虽然最近一些中国城市房价已经超越我们的想象力,但是从这张图里还是可以看到,我们仍是一个人均非常穷的国家。

mailper 轶事趣闻 Google, Google Public Data Explorer
用Python写过处理文本经常会遇到需要decoding或者encoding, 尤其是处理中文的时候。
encoding的问题处理起来是个脏活儿,报错不太容易看懂,网上相关资料不太好查。有同感?请继续读下去。
常规做法是读取文件的时候立刻decode, 所有的处理工作都用unicode,写会文件的时候encode. 但是等到读取的时候在处理的代码读/写起来都很别扭,感觉像穿上鞋以后袜子滑下来了…Python 3.1.1以上的版本解决了该问题。在Python 3.1.1中,打开文件可以加入encoding的参数:
file = open(filename, encoding='xxx')
啊,这样看起来终于舒坦了。 不同写如下的code了
file = open(filename)
for line in file:
decoded_line = line.decode('xxx')
do something else
提倡使用utf8
mailper Python Python
应网友workout和其他热心读者的要求,我罗列一些自己觉得值得推荐的feed。用纯文字罗列如下,想找到以下的话可以通过Google。希望大家在此互相分享。
适合读者:广谱技术爱好者,国外互联网信息爱好者,用户行为和设计爱好者, 语言爱好者,阅读狂。
技术类
- Coding horror
- Joel on software
- unified Python planet
业界信息
- 谷歌黑板报
- Search Blog: Bing
- Search
- 百度爱好者
- silicon valley watcher
- Google Blogscoped
- Google Code Blog
- 月光博客
- apple4us
- 古奥
- 望月的博客
- Google Operating System
杰出个人博客
- Paul Graham Essays
- Pure Pleasure – lixiaolai.com
- The noisy channel
- 李开复新浪博客
- 韩寒博客
- the trump blog
- Matt Cutts
- Linus blog
- Paul Buchheit (Gmail创始人)
- Peter Norvig (人工智能大儒, Google 研究总监)
- too (Google 创始人博客)
- Alon Halevy’s Blog
- Daniel Lemire’s blog
- Clay Shirky
- Earning My Turns
- How to change the world
阅读全文…
mailper 技术新闻, 技术读物, 杂项资源 Reader, RSS
如果你不是订阅本站的用户,你很肯能可能是通过搜索引擎的魔力来到本文的。
微软的软件产品咱们暂且不谈,他们生产的键盘鼠标确实很不错。例如,经典的 microsoft natural ergonomic keyboard 4000 (见图)。著名Google工程师博主Matt Cutts用的就是这个(参考链接)。
可是每个入手该键盘的geek都会觉得,这个弱智的设计师把zoom键放在中间干嘛,应该用来当上下滚轮嘛。

无独有偶,该问题已经被先辈们解决,笔者只搜到了英文文章
为了让中文读者方便找到并使用,暂且将关键步骤翻译如下:
- 下载微软键盘驱动 http://www.microsoft.com/hardware/download/download.aspx?category=MK
- 找到command.xml文件,应该是在 C:\Program Files\Microsoft IntelliType Pro\
- 编辑command.xml文件(建议之前备份),替换所有 <C319 Type=”6″ Activator=”ZoomIn” /> 为<C319 Type=”6″ Activator=”ScrollUp” />, 所有 <C320 Type=”6″ Activator=”ZoomOut” /> 替换为 <C320 Type=”6″ Activator=”ScrollDown” /> 用Notepad或者记事本可以实现,应该是10个左右。
- 重启电脑(貌似这一步不能省)
图例:修改前

图例:修改后

这样你就可以用Zoom来替代鼠标滚轮了。
mailper 杂项资源 键盘
相信不少读者都是通过Google Reader (貌似没有中文名) 看到本文的,而多数Google Reader的爱好者都是贪婪的。如果你像我一样,估计未读数量从来都是1000+。遇到强迫症就麻烦了。下面一个方法能让阅读变得有“轻重缓急”。
- 承认不是所有种子一样重要,有些更新你想立刻知道(例如某新闻类的博客:古奥),有些只是希望不要错过(例如某经典博客:Joe l on Software),还有一些可能只是娱乐用的(例如:煎蛋)
- Reader是可以为种子建文件夹的,所有“重要而必读”的种子都可以放在一个文件夹里,文件夹的名称最好是用“_” 开头,这样排序的时候可以在最前面(见图解)
- 每当打开Google Reader的时候,先看重要的种子即可,其他的有时间再读。
笔者的Reader界面(献丑了)

mailper 编程语言 Google, Google Reader
Google 今天发布了自制的编程语言,叫做Go,官方网站如下:
主要参与者名单繁星满天:
Logo图标 (一只 Gopher, 金花鼠,作者 Renée French)

为什么Google要做自己的编程语言呢?
似乎Google内部官方编程语言之战在即… C, C++, Java, Python, JavaScript, and now Go and Zimbu(by VIM 的作者)
Go programming language Tech Talk
mailper 编程语言 Go, Google
最近评论